Caribbean Discourse: Selected Essays

Édouard Glissant
4.3
139 ratings 9 reviews
Selected essays from the rich and complex collection of Edouard Glissant, one of the most prominent writers and intellectuals of the Caribbean, examine the psychological, sociological, and philosophical implications of cultural dependency.
